Job Summary: Your Role as a Talent Acquisition Specialist

We’re looking for an enthusiastic, skilled, and dedicated Recruiter to join our growing team. In this essential role, you will find and attract top caregiving talent. Specifically, you will build our team of compassionate professionals. Your expertise in identifying quality candidates is crucial. This means understanding both skills and character. You will assess cultural fit and commitment to care. Ultimately, this leads to stronger teams and better client outcomes. You will be central to building our caregiving family.

Key Responsibilities: What You Will Do

  • Talent Sourcing and Attraction: Actively source and attract qualified caregivers. Use multiple channels including job boards, social media, and referrals. Moreover, build a strong pipeline of potential candidates.
  • Screening and Interviewing: You will carefully screen applications and conduct thorough interviews. This means evaluating experience, skills, and character. Also, you will assess each candidate’s commitment to compassionate care.
  • Background Verification: You will manage comprehensive background checks efficiently. For instance, you will verify references and certifications. You will also ensure all regulatory requirements are met.
  • Candidate Experience Management: Provide exceptional candidate experience throughout the hiring process. This means clear communication and timely feedback. Keep candidates informed and engaged.
  • Compliance and Documentation: Strictly follow all California hiring regulations. For example, maintain proper documentation and ensure equal opportunity practices. Keep up with employment law changes.
  • Onboarding Coordination: Carefully coordinate smooth onboarding processes. This covers orientation scheduling and document collection. It also includes training coordination and integration support.
  • Relationship Building: Actively build relationships with healthcare schools and training programs. Create partnerships for ongoing talent pipeline. Also, maintain networks within the caregiving community.
  • Data and Reporting: Track recruitment metrics and hiring success rates. Always improve recruitment strategies. Provide regular reports on hiring activities and outcomes.

Qualifications: What You Bring

  • Proven experience (3+ years preferred) in recruiting or talent acquisition. Preferably, this is within healthcare, home care, or related service industries.
  • You have excellent interviewing and assessment skills. You can also identify quality candidates quickly. This role requires strong judgment in a competitive market.
  • You have outstanding communication and interpersonal skills. Also, strong relationship-building abilities are essential. You are professional, persuasive, and approachable.
  • You know recruiting software and applicant tracking systems well. Social media recruiting and job board management are also needed.
  • You can work independently and manage multiple priorities. And you meet deadlines consistently, even under pressure.
  • Good knowledge of California employment laws and hiring practices is a big plus.
  • You truly want to build exceptional caregiving teams. You are committed to finding people who share our values of compassionate care.
